Bungie to end Destiny 2 live-service updates June 9, 2026
Bungie will stop active Destiny 2 development; the final live-service update arrives June 9, 2026 as the studio shifts staff to new projects.
Bungie announced in a studio blog post that it will end active development on Destiny 2 and release the final live-service content update on June 9, 2026. After that date the studio will stop producing new live-service content for the game.
Bungie wrote the decision follows completion of The Final Shape storyline and a shift in studio priorities to incubate new games. “While our love for Destiny 2 has not changed, it has become clear that after The Final Shape, we have reached the time for our shared worlds, and Destiny, to live beyond Destiny 2,” the post reads. The studio added that work on new projects will begin after the June update.
The June 9 update is described as large and definitive. Planned changes include the return of the in-game Director, new missions intended to close certain character arcs and storylines, adjustments to weapons and class systems, and revisions to how players purchase cosmetics. Bungie published a full list of technical and gameplay changes on its blog.
The post did not confirm whether Bungie will continue the Destiny franchise under a new title. The studio currently lists Marathon, an extraction shooter released earlier this year, as its other active title while staff shift to new developments.
Destiny launched in 2014 and Destiny 2 arrived in 2017. Since then Bungie has issued annual expansions and ongoing live-service updates, and the series has maintained an active community for nearly a decade.
The June 2026 update will be the last scheduled live-service content release from Bungie for Destiny 2. After that date the studio’s public development focus will be on incubating and building new projects.
